Rising Urbanization, Lifestyle Changes, and Demand for Protein-Rich Foods Fuel Market Growth
Noida, India – August 7, 2025 – According to Renub Research's latest report, Saudi Arabia Processed Meat Market is projected to reach US$ 8.38 Billion by 2033, up from US$ 5.14 Billion in 2024, growing at a CAGR of 5.60% from 2025 to 2033. The market's robust trajectory is driven by rapid urbanization, a growing expat population, changes in consumer eating habits, increased preference for convenience foods, and rising awareness of protein-rich diets.\

Key Growth Drivers
1. Urbanization and Rising Disposable Income
The Kingdom of Saudi Arabia is undergoing unprecedented urban growth. More than 84% of the population currently resides in urban areas, according to World Bank data. Urban living often translates into time constraints and a preference for ready-to-eat or easy-to-cook food products. Coupled with a surge in disposable incomes, urban consumers are increasingly turning to processed meat options for both convenience and taste.
2. Changing Dietary Patterns
While traditional Saudi meals remain popular, there is an evident shift in consumer preferences toward Western-style food habits. Processed meat, such as hot dogs, sausages, and pre-cooked poultry or beef, is being widely adopted due to its convenience, flavor, and longer shelf life.
3. Health Awareness and Protein Consumption
With rising awareness of nutrition and fitness, processed meats—especially lean poultry and beef products—are gaining traction for being rich in protein. Health-conscious consumers are opting for low-fat, high-protein, and minimally processed meat options available in the market.
4. Expanding Retail and E-commerce Channels
Saudi Arabia’s retail ecosystem is rapidly growing. Modern retail formats such as hypermarkets, supermarkets, and convenience stores are major distribution channels for processed meat. In addition, the online retail market has surged, driven by increased smartphone usage, tech-savvy consumers, and fast delivery options. This has opened up new growth avenues for both local and global processed meat brands.
Market Segmentation Insights
By Meat Type
· Poultry remains the most preferred processed meat due to its affordability and versatility. It accounts for a significant portion of market share.
· Beef follows closely, supported by rising demand among expats and affluent locals.
· Pork, while restricted due to cultural and religious reasons, has niche demand among non-Muslim expatriates.
· Other meats, including lamb and seafood, also contribute to the diversity of the market.
By Processed Type
· Frozen meat dominates the market, favored for its longer shelf life and ease of storage.
· Chilled meat is gaining popularity among premium consumers seeking freshness.
· Canned meat remains a convenient option for rural consumers and for emergency stock-ups.
By Distribution Channel
· Hypermarkets and Supermarkets lead in processed meat sales, offering a variety of brands and products under one roof.
· Convenience stores are vital for last-minute and small-quantity purchases.
· Online retail stores are growing rapidly, especially post-pandemic, providing contactless delivery and digital promotions.
Market Challenges
Despite strong growth, the Saudi Arabia processed meat market faces several challenges:
· Health Concerns: Increased scrutiny around preservatives, sodium content, and artificial additives in processed meat can deter health-conscious consumers.
· Halal Certification: All processed meat products must meet strict halal standards, limiting the introduction of certain international brands.
· Price Sensitivity: The market is price-sensitive, especially among low-income consumers, requiring manufacturers to balance cost and quality.

Government Initiatives and Regulations
The Saudi Food and Drug Authority (SFDA) is actively regulating processed meat products to ensure food safety, halal compliance, and quality. Additionally, the government’s localization initiatives are encouraging domestic production and reducing dependence on imports. These efforts are further supporting market expansion and reducing supply chain vulnerabilities.
